Visual Studio 2019 is now available
News|by Leanne Bevan|3 April 2019
Microsoft has released Visual Studio 2019 and Visual Studio 2019 for Mac.
Users can benefit from individual and team productivity, modern development support and constant innovation. In addition, the latest Mac version comes with a number of great new features and performance improvements.
